Weeds
Q: How tall do weeds/grass need to be to avoid violation?
A: Anything over 15” is a violation. (City Ordinance 98-19)
Sidewalks
Q: What is the clearance needed for trees over sidewalks?
A: Trees over sidewalks need to have a 7.5 foot clearance. (City Ordinance 98-19)
Q: Am I responsible for sidewalk maintenance?
A: Property owners are responsible to maintain sidewalks and right-of-ways free of grass or weeds. Property owners shall control the overgrowth of bushes that may impede or delay public access to the sidewalk. (City Ordinance 98-19)
Trash Pickup
Q: What days are designated for trash pick up and who is in charge?
A: Monday and Thursdays are trash pick up and Waste Management (Collier County) is the vendor and can be reached at 649-2212.
Receptacles
Q: When should I place my receptacles outside?
A: You may place your receptacles outside after 6:00 p.m. the night before pickup and you must have them removed by 7:00 p.m. the day of pickup.
Bulk Trash
Q: What days are recycled and/or bulk items picked up?
A: Recyclables are picked up on Thursdays only.
Q: If I have a bulk pickup (couch, refrigerator, yard waste, etc.) who do I call?
A: You need to contact Waste Management prior to bulk/recycle pickup day to make arrangements. (649-2212) You may place your receptacles outside after 6:00 p.m. the night before pickup and you must have them removed by 7:00 p.m. the day of pickup
Trailer
Q: Can I park my trailer in my driveway/yard?
A: You may park your trailer (boat/sea doo/utility) for 8 hours for the purpose of loading, unloading or cleaning. (City Ordinance 01-15)
Q: Is there any place I can park my trailer on my property?
A: You may park your trailer (boat/sea doo/utility) on your property for permanent parking if parked within the confines of a fully enclosed structure that the trailer can not be seen from any abutting property, public road way or waterway. (City Ordinance 01-15)
Recreational Vehicles
Q: Can I park my RV in my driveway/property?
A: You may park your RV in the driveway as long as it does not block the sidewalk with a City permit affixed to the vehicle in a conspicuous place. You may obtain a 7-day permit at Marco Island City Hall at no charge. You are allowed 28 days per calendar year for RV parking, however not consecutive. NOTE: All applications are required to have a City authorized signature to be effective. (City Ordinance 01-15)
Q: Can you live in an RV parked at your home?
A: No sleeping or living activities are allowed within the vehicle while parked. (City Ordinance 01-15)
Garage/Yard Sales
Q: How many times a year can I have a garage/yard sale?
A: You are allowed 1 garage/yard sale per calendar year. You can obtain a 2-day permit at City Hall. NOTE: All applications are required to have a City authorized signature to be effective. (City Ordinance 01-15)
Q: Are there any restrictions to garage/yard sale signs?
A: One sign is permitted on property where the actual garage sale is taking place. No sign shall be placed in any public right-of-way or on private property. (City Ordinance 01-15)
Vehicle
Q: Is there a permit required to sell my vehicle?
A: One (1) 14-day permit per property per calendar year may be issued to display a vehicle “For Sale” sign affixed to the window . Permits shall only be issued to the title-holder of the vehicle who shall either be the owner of the subject property, or able to produce an affidavit of permission from the property owner. NOTE: All applications are required to have a City authorized signature to be effective. (City Ordinance 01-15)
Q: What if my vehicle has expired tags?
A: Any vehicle offered for sale must have a valid license plate and be parked on the driveway or an impervious surface intended for vehicle parking. The permit must be clearly affixed to the window. (City Ordinance 01-15)
Q: Can I park my vehicle for sale in a public parking lot?
A: No vehicle for sale shall be parked on a vacant residential lot or in the public right-of-way. (City Ordinance 01-15)
For Sale
Q: Can I put a “For Sale” sign up in my front yard when selling my home?
A: One (1) ground or wall “For Sale” or “For Rent” sign is permissible for each lot having street frontage. If a lot also has frontage on a navigable water body or a golf course, one (1) additional sign shall be permitted. (City Ordinance 02-11)
Q: What size can the “For Sale” or “For Rent” sign be?
A: Residential single-family: 1.5 square feet; residential multi-family: Four (4) square feet; non-residential: Four (4) square feet. Maximum height is three (3) feet as measured from finished grade around the base of the sign. (City Ordinance 02-11)
Q: Is there a certain color the “For Sale” sign has to be?
A: A suggested sign background color is white. The lettering can be of any color and 20% of the sign face may include the display of a logo, which may include multiple colors. (City Ordinance 02-11)
Q: Can I put a “For Sale” sign in the swale?
A: Signs may be placed at the property line of the subject property. Signs are not allowed within the public right-of-way; signs may be located either parallel to or perpendicular to the adjacent right-of-way; no sign will be located any closer than ten (10) feet to the edge of the pavement of any adjacent public street. (City Ordinance 02-11)
Q: Can I attach an information sheet to my “For Sale” sign?
A: No additional riders or information boxes shall be affixed to the “For Sale” sign. (City Ordinance 02-11)
Q: Once my home is sold can I place a “Sold” or “Pending” sign to the “For Sale” sign?
A: Yes, until closing is complete. (City Ordinance 02-11)
Q: Is my realtors name allowed on the “For Sale” sign?
A: You are allowed to have any of the following two (2) on your “For Sale’ sign: name, address, telephone number, website address of the property owner and/or real estate broker and/or investment company or business firm licensed to sell real estate in Florida and/or sales person or real estate broker. (City Ordinance 02-11)
Q: Can my “For Sale” sign be double sided?
A: Signs may be double-faced, provided each sign face contains the same copy. The real estate agent’s name is not required to be the same on each side of the sign. (City Ordinance 02-11)
Q: How soon after the sale of my property does the “For Sale” or “For Rent” need to come down?
A: Signs shall be removed within seven (7) days after the ownership has changed or the property is no longer for sale or rent. (City Ordinance 02-11)
Open House
Q: Am I allowed to put an “Open House” sign up?
A: One (1) “open house” sign, no larger than four (4) square feet may be erected on the property line where the open house is taking place. Such sign shall be removed at the completion of the open house and during non-supervised hours. No permit is required. (City Ordinance 02-11)
Q: How many directional signs am I allowed for an “Open House”?
A: One right-of-way directional sign is allowed during supervised open house and shall be placed at the intersection of the arterial or collector street providing access to the street on which the open house is being conducted. No other off-site signs shall be permitted. Such sign shall be removed at the completion of the open house and during non-supervised hours. (City Ordinance 02-11)
Model Homes
Q: How many signs are allowed at a “Model Home” site?
A: One on-premise sign for a model home or sales center in conjunction with an approved temporary use permit is permitted. (City Ordinance 02-15)
Q: Are there any size restrictions for a “Model Home” sign?
A: Maximum size is 16 square feet. Maximum height is 6 feet as measured from finished grade around the base of the sign. (City Ordinance 02-15)
Q: Can I put a “Model Home” sign in the swale?
A: Signs may be placed at the property line of the subject property. Signs are not allowed within the public right-of-way; signs may be located either parallel to or perpendicular to the adjacent right-of-way; no sign will be located any closer than ten (10) feet to the edge of the pavement of any adjacent public street. (City Ordinance 02-15)
Q: Is there a certain color the “Model Home” sign has to be?
A: No, but a suggested background color is white. The lettering can be of any color and 20% of the sign face may include the display of a logo, which may include multiple colors. (City Ordinance 02-15)
Q: What information can be placed on a “Model Home” sign?
A: You may place the name of the model; name, address, phone number and logo of the developer/builder; name, address, phone number and logo of the real estate company/broker, investment company of business firm licensed to sell real estate in Florida; signs may be double-faced, provided each sign face contains the same copy. No additional riders or information boxes shall be affixed to this sign. (City Ordinance 02-15)
Q: Can I have “For Sale” and a “Model Home” signs on the same property?
A: No other signs, including real estate, open house and construction signs shall be placed on the property on which a model home sign is erected. (City Ordinance 02-15)
Q: Can a flag be flown at a “Model Home” site?
A: One (1) American flag, attached to the home or upon an appropriate flagpole foundation is permitted. No other flags are allowed. (City Ordinance 02-15)
Plywood
Q: Can I use plywood as a sign?
A: Plywood is not permissible as a finished sign face. Signs and any supporting structure shall be constructed of CBS, wood (with raised or engraved letters), stone metal, or durable opaque plastic.
